Junior Estates Manager

Job description

Due to exponential growth, there is now an opportunity and a requirement within a very well-known property management company for a Junior Estates Manager to join their team

As Estates Manager, you will be responsible for the management of a diverse and UK-wide property portfolio in accordance with statutory guidance and operational requirements. Leading from the front, setting the example, and standards to the wider team.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Negotiating heads of terms, rent reviews, lease renewals, and dilapidations.
  • Responsible for drafting Schedules of Condition, writing fit-out specs Including basic layout/design drawings.
  • Responsible for the completion of accurate leases.
  • Completing valuations.
  • Collating and presenting research as required.
  • Reviewing and analysing valuations.
  • Leading projects when required.
  • Any other responsibilities as and when required.
  • Managing vacant unit business rates
  • Line management experience

Skills and Experience:

  • Day-to-day residential and commercial property management experience.
  • Exceptional knowledge of all aspects of property-related legislation and regulations.
  • Excellent diligence and understanding of client requirements.
  • Excellent communication skills across a wide range of stakeholders.
  • Able to use initiative and support with a diverse, varied caseload and self-manage own projects.
  • Knowledge of proprietary databases, ideally Ten90, Qube and Meridian
  • Able to work in a fast-paced, rapidly changing environment.
  • Competent in using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• A full, clean driving licence.
